How to Make Irresistible French Toast Cups for Cozy Mornings

  1. Prepare the bread: Tear bread into small pieces and place in a mixing bowl.
  2. Soak the bread: Whisk eggs, milk, vanilla extract, cinnamon, and salt. Pour over bread and let soak for 15 minutes.
  3. Preheat the oven: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
  4. Fill the muffin tin: Spray muffin tin with cooking spray. Fill each cup with the bread mixture, pressing down gently.
  5. Bake: Bake for 20-25 minutes or until golden and crispy.
  6. Serve: Let cool for a few minutes, then serve with your favorite toppings.

Cook's Tips for Perfect Irresistible French Toast Cups for Cozy Mornings

  • Common mistake and fix: Don't over-soak the bread. If it becomes too soggy, your French Toast Cups won't have that crispy edge.
  • Pro tip: For extra crispy edges, bake for an additional 2-3 minutes after the initial 20 minutes.
  • Pro tip: To make ahead, prepare the bread mixture the night before and refrigerate. In the morning, fill the muffin tin and bake as directed.

Storing & Reheating Irresistible French Toast Cups for Cozy Mornings

Short-Term Storage

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Make-ahead tip: Prepare the bread mixture the night before and refrigerate. In the morning, fill the muffin tin and bake as directed.

Freezing Irresistible French Toast Cups for Cozy Mornings

Freeze cooled French Toast Cups for up to 2 months.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 10-15 minutes.

How to Reheat Without Drying It Out

Oven: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 10-15 minutes. Microwave: Reheat in the microwave for 20-30 seconds, but be careful not to overheat.
